Internships

To participate in our internship program, the applicant must be a student or professional participating in a sponsored internship program for educational benefit, and must be available no less than 8 hours per week.  Previous work experience is not necessary; however, the applicant must display the high level of diligence, responsibility, and professionalism appropriate to a Congressional office.

The intern will be provided an opportunity to observe and participate in the legislative process, as well as constituent services through a variety of activities in the Congressman's Washington or District offices.  He or she will gain first-hand experience in the daily functions of the office, participating in general office support and interacting with all members of the staff.  Responsibilities will also include at least one special project.  The special project will be defined at a time of hire according to the needs of the office, and tailored to the applicant's educational or professional goals whenever possible.
